Fondly known as Fergie, she retains the title of Duchess of York, but is she a princess? Is Sarah Ferguson a princess? The answer is no. Sarah Ferguson is not a princess.
Why does the Duchess of York still have her title?
After her divorce, she retained the title Sarah, Duchess of York. When Fergie married Prince Andrew, she received the titles of Her Royal Highness and The Duchess of York. After their split, her title became Sarah, Duchess of York, as is the customary styling for former wives of peers.
What does Duchess of York mean?
Duchess of York is the principal courtesy title held by the wife of the duke of York. Three of the eleven dukes of York either did not marry or had already assumed the throne prior to marriage, whilst two of the dukes married twice, therefore there have been only ten duchesses of York.

Was the Duchess of York a commoner?
Sarah was born a commoner and worked in a London graphic arts office. She married Andrew in a fairy-tale Westminster Abbey ceremony full of royal pomp and circumstance and seen on television by millions worldwide on July 23, 1986.
Is a Duchess higher than a Prince?
A Duke or Duchess is the rank that is typically the highest below the monarch. Often Prince and Princesses will also hold a dukedom, similar to Prince William, who now holds the title of the Duke of Cornwall and Cambridge.
Is a Duchess higher than a lady?
lady, in the British Isles, a general title for any peeress below the rank of duchess and also for the wife of a baronet or of a knight.
Can a duke’s daughter be called a princess?
The daughters of a duke, marquess or earl have the courtesy title of “Lady” before their forename and surname.
What is the difference between a princess and a Duchess?
The main difference is that princesses are typically blood related, and duchesses are made. For example, Markle was granted the Duchess of Sussex title when she married Prince Harry, but she’ll never be an actual princess because she wasn’t born into the royal family.
Does marrying a prince make you a princess?
In European countries, a woman who marries a prince will almost always become a princess, but a man who marries a princess will almost never become a prince, unless specifically created so.

Who will inherit Duke of York title?
A future monarch would then have the ability to bestow the title as a royal Duchy, in what would be its ninth creation. Prince Louis, the second son of William, Prince of Wales, is the most likely candidate to be the next Duke of York after the death of his great-uncle, Prince Andrew, and after William becomes King.

What happens if a princess marry a commoner?
You might be ousted from the family
In some countries, when a royal member marries a commoner, they must give up their crown altogether. When Japan’s Princess Mako marries her college sweetheart, she’ll have to give up her crown, royal status, and her place in the royal family.
Is Camilla considered a commoner?
The simple answer is yes, Camilla was a commoner before she married Prince Charles. She was born into a family of British nobility, but her parents were not members of the royal family.

What is the daughter of a Duchess called?
The honorific courtesy style of “Lady” is used for the daughters of dukes, marquesses, and earls. The courtesy title is added before the person’s given name, as in the examples Lady Diana Spencer and Lady Henrietta Waldegrave.
